Definition of Attenborough in the English dictionary

The definition of Attenborough in the dictionary is Sir David. born 1926, British naturalist and broadcaster; noted esp for his TV series Life on Earth, The Living Planet, The Life of Birds, The Life of Mammals, and First Life. Other definition of Attenborough is his brother, Richard, Baron Attenborough. born 1923, British film actor, director, and producer; his films include Gandhi, Cry Freedom, and Shadowlands.
